Output 6a8f90daaf81bacf00658ebdc5496fdc58e9a946d16d1128fcfb6da991987383:3

value
277812868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c99014aa159f0f1290bbdc2d66c89d273823201 OP_EQUAL
address
34JE8tgdQKgw7zM4XUUi4a2t96RmLAg1bP
transaction
6a8f90daaf81bacf00658ebdc5496fdc58e9a946d16d1128fcfb6da991987383
spent
true